Factors to Consider When Buying a Couch
When acquiring a couch, numerous elements should be taken into factor to consider to ensure the finest choice for specific needs. Here's a list of vital considerations:
Size and Layout: Measure your space to guarantee the couch fits conveniently without overcrowding the space. Think about the layout and circulation of the space.
Comfort Level: Test the couch by resting on it to assess assistance, softness, and general convenience.
Resilience: Look for top quality materials and construction. Think about how frequently the couch will be used and by whom (e.g., kids, pets).
Style Compatibility: Ensure the couch design matches the space's total decoration and visual.
Spending plan: Determine a spending plan before shopping and search for alternatives within that variety to prevent overspending.
Functionality: Consider if you need additional features like reclining chairs or pull-out beds based upon your lifestyle.
4. Couch Maintenance Tips
Keeping a couch in excellent condition requires regular maintenance. Here are some ideas for lengthening the life of a couch:
Regular Cleaning: Vacuum the couch frequently to remove dust and particles. For material couches, think about professional cleaning every number of years.
Secure from Sunlight: Position the couch far from direct sunshine to prevent fading and damage gradually.
Use Coasters: If utilizing the couch for snacks or drinks, consider using coasters to prevent spots.
Turn Cushions: If your couch has detachable cushions, rotate them regularly to ensure even use.
Use Fabric Protectors: Use fabric protectors suitable for your couch material to enhance stain resistance.
5.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: What size couch need to I purchase for a little apartment?A: For small spaces, consider a loveseat or a compact sectional. Measure the area and pick a couch that enables comfortable motion around the room.
Q: How do I choose a color for my couch?A: Consider the existing decor and color design of your home. Neutral colors can be versatile, while vibrant colors can serve as a statement piece. Q: Can I personalize my couch?A: Many sellers use modification options, including material choice, color, dimensions, and additional features. Talk to the seller for custom choices. Q: Are leather couches worth the investment?A: While leather couches can be more expensive in advance, they normally offer resilience and ease of upkeep, possibly saving money in the long run. Q: How long should a good couch last?A: With appropriate care, a high-quality couch can last anywhere from 7 to 15 years or longer. Factors like use and material quality can influence longevity.
